第三次团队作业——UML设计
这个作业要求在哪里 | https://edu.cnblogs.com/campus/fzzcxy/2018SE2/homework/11366 |
---|---|
团队名称 | 您为何会咸鱼 |
这个作业目标 | 团队间的三次合作,制作博客,对项目进行需求分析,UML设计 |
作业正文 | 第二次团队作业——团队展示 |
其他参考文献 | https://zhuanlan.zhihu.com/p/148435145 |
队名
"您为何会咸鱼"
拟作的团队项目描述
通过上传自己拥有的笔记、复习资料来共享学习资源学习
项目分工
名称 | 分管任务 |
---|---|
张何毓 and 陈小雨 | 团队项目前端部分 |
黄志辉 | 后端的文件上传部分 |
陈显 | 后端的浏览部分 |
林俊威 and 林佳森 | 数据库 |
林佳森 | 进行最终各部分的连接部分 |
张何毓 and 陈小雨 | 进行项目的测试部分 |
本次作业前期分工
UML设计图前期草稿
由于我们的帅气男同学在课上充分讨论了两节课,并且不懂的时候咨询了老师,最终,出现了如下草图设计稿
字比较丑,将就着看看!
UML设计图
活动图
- 选择资料类型,是选择是“考试相关信息(透题、押题)”和“文件(试题、笔记)”
- 考试相关信息是在一个文本框内输入发布,不审核考试相关信息是因为我们考虑加入敏感词名单,有敏感词会变成“****”
- 选择资料信息是选择上传的资料的“年份、科目”
其中将文件给管理员审核是一个我们目前所困恼的问题
用例图
状态图
管理员状态图
使用者状态图
程序状态图
时序图
上传部分
浏览部分
工具选择
processOn
ProcessOn的使用非常简单,我们只需通过注册便可获得这一永久免费的服务。ProcessOn被设计的足够简洁和高效,没有打扰的广告信息,这些专业知识和工具服务正是我们UML设计所需的。ProcessOn支持vsdx、xmind、txt、excel等格式文件的导入,支持导出高清png、jpg、pdf等格式文件。满足多场景的下载需求。